Question 2 of 5

During assessment, the nurse would expect which part of the body to indicate central cyanosis in a client with a severe asthma attack?

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: The oral mucosa is the most reliable site for assessing central cyanosis, reflecting systemic oxygenation status in highly vascularized tissue.

Question 4 of 5

A nurse measures a patient height and weight and calculate his BMI. Patient BMI is 37. Classify according to this BMI results?

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: A BMI of 37 falls within the range of 35 to 39.9, classified as Obesity Class II per WHO guidelines.

Question 5 of 5

Which risk factor for traumatic brain injury (TBI) should a nurse include in a discussion about prevention for a group of adolescents?

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: Adolescents are particularly susceptible to TBIs due to their frequent involvement in contact sports like football, soccer, and hockey, as well as risky behaviors associated with driving. These activities are leading causes of TBIs in this age group.
